Pet owners and cleaning professionals are increasingly using AI-powered devices for stain removal. Experts confirm that while AI can assist, it is not yet fully reliable for all pet stains, raising questions about trust and effectiveness.
Recent evaluations by cleaning experts and consumer reports reveal that AI-powered pet stain removal devices are gaining popularity but still face significant limitations in effectively cleaning all types of pet stains. While these devices offer convenience, experts warn that their reliability varies depending on stain type and surface, raising questions about whether consumers can fully trust AI for this task.
Multiple brands of AI-enabled cleaning devices are now marketed specifically for pet stain removal, promising ease of use and quick results. However, according to industry professionals, the technology is still evolving. A recent review by the Cleaning Technology Institute found that AI-powered devices perform well on fresh, light stains but often struggle with older or deeply embedded pet marks, especially on textured or porous surfaces.
Consumer feedback collected over the past six months indicates mixed experiences. Some pet owners report satisfactory results with certain devices, while others express frustration over persistent stains or residual odors. Experts emphasize that AI systems rely heavily on image recognition and pre-programmed algorithms, which can be limited in handling complex stain scenarios.
Dr. Lisa Chen, a chemist specializing in cleaning agents, notes, “AI can assist in identifying stains and applying targeted cleaning solutions, but it cannot yet replace the nuanced judgment of experienced human cleaners, especially for stubborn pet messes.”

Evolution of AI Cleaning Devices and Market Adoption
The adoption of AI-powered cleaning devices has accelerated over the past three years, driven by advancements in machine learning, image recognition, and automation. Major brands like Robovac and PetClean have introduced models with AI features aimed at pet owners, promising targeted stain detection and removal. Industry analysts note that the market is still in a nascent stage, with ongoing improvements and consumer feedback shaping future iterations.
Historically, pet stain removal has been a challenging aspect of home cleaning, often requiring manual scrubbing and specialized cleaning solutions. The integration of AI aims to streamline this process, but the technology’s effectiveness varies across different stain types and surfaces. Prior studies and reviews suggest that while AI devices excel in surface-level cleaning, they often fall short on deeply embedded or old stains, which require more intensive manual treatment.
Recent tests and consumer reports highlight that AI systems are still learning and adapting, with some models showing promising results in controlled environments but inconsistent performance in real-world scenarios.

Key Questions
Can AI devices fully replace manual cleaning for pet stains?
Currently, AI devices are best suited for light, fresh stains and routine cleaning. They are not yet capable of fully replacing manual cleaning, especially for stubborn or old stains.
What types of pet stains are AI devices most effective on?
AI devices tend to perform better on recent, surface-level stains on hard, smooth surfaces. They are less effective on deeply embedded stains or on textured, porous surfaces like carpets with thick padding.
Are there safety concerns with AI cleaning devices?
As with all electrical appliances, users should follow safety instructions, such as unplugging devices during maintenance and keeping liquids away from electronic components. It is recommended to use appropriate cleaning solutions compatible with the device.
How can I improve my chances of successful stain removal with AI devices?
Pre-treat stains with appropriate cleaning agents, remove excess mess promptly, and follow manufacturer instructions carefully. Combining manual pre-cleaning with AI-assisted cleaning can yield better results.
Will AI technology improve enough to trust it for all pet stains?
Ongoing advancements suggest that AI will become more reliable over time, but currently, it should be used as a supplement rather than a complete solution for challenging pet stains.
